The National Bank Open runs from 1 to 13 August 2026, with the men at IGA Stadium in Montreal and the women at Sobeys Stadium in Toronto. The two draws carry a combined purse of just under $17 million.
National Bank Open 2026 Prize Money
| Event | Host city | Total prize pool |
|---|---|---|
| ATP Masters 1000 | Montreal | $9,415,725 |
| WTA 1000 | Toronto | $7,433,076 |
| Combined | $16,848,801 |
The cities swap each year. The men played Toronto in 2025 and are in Montreal for 2026, with the women making the reverse move.
Ranking Points
Both singles champions earn 1,000 ranking points, the standard award at Masters 1000 and WTA 1000 level. With the top three men all absent from Montreal this year, those points are unusually available: a title here would be worth more to the chasing pack than the prize cheque.

How It Compares
Canada sits level with Cincinnati the following week, both being combined events at the same tier. The US Open, which closes the swing, pays several times more.
